+/**
+ * struct link_req - information about an ongoing link setup request
+ * @bearer: bearer issuing requests
+ * @dest: destination address for request messages
+ * @buf: request message to be (repeatedly) sent
+ * @timer: timer governing period between requests
+ * @timer_intv: current interval between requests (in ms)
+ */
+struct link_req {
+       struct bearer *bearer;
+       struct tipc_media_addr dest;
+       struct sk_buff *buf;
+       struct timer_list timer;
+       unsigned int timer_intv;
+};

+/**
+ * tipc_disc_stop_link_req - stop sending periodic link setup requests
+ * @req: ptr to link request structure
+ */
+
+void tipc_disc_stop_link_req(struct link_req *req) 
+{
+       if (!req)
+               return;
+               
+       k_cancel_timer(&req->timer);
+       k_term_timer(&req->timer);
+       buf_discard(req->buf);
+       kfree(req);
+} 
+
+/**
+ * tipc_disc_update_link_req - update frequency of periodic link setup requests
+ * @req: ptr to link request structure
+ */
+
+void tipc_disc_update_link_req(struct link_req *req) 
+{
+       if (!req)
+               return;
+
+       if (req->timer_intv == T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W) {
+               if (!req->bearer->nodes.count) {
+                       req->timer_intv = TIPC_LINK_REQ_FAST;
+                       k_start_timer(&req->timer, req->timer_intv);
+               }
+       } else if (req->timer_intv == TIPC_LINK_REQ_FAST) {
+               if (req->bearer->nodes.count) {
+                       req->timer_intv = T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W;
+                       k_start_timer(&req->timer, req->timer_intv);
+               }
+       } else {
+               /* leave timer "as is" if haven't yet reached a "normal" rate */
+       }
+} 
+
+/**
+ * disc_timeout - send a periodic link setup request
+ * @req: ptr to link request structure
+ * 
+ * Called whenever a link setup request timer associated with a bearer expires.
+ */
+
+static void disc_timeout(struct link_req *req) 
+{
+       spin_lock_bh(&req->bearer->publ.lock);
+
+       req->bearer->media->send_msg(req->buf, &req->bearer->publ, &req->dest);
+
+       if ((req->timer_intv == T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W) ||
+           (req->timer_intv == TIPC_LINK_REQ_FAST)) {
+               /* leave timer interval "as is" if already at a "normal" rate */
+       } else {
+               req->timer_intv *= 2;
+               if (req->timer_intv > T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W)
+                       req->timer_intv = T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W;
+               if ((req->timer_intv == TIPC_LINK_REQ_FAST) && 
+                   (req->bearer->nodes.count))
+                       req->timer_intv = TIPC_LINK_REQ_SLOW;
+       }
+       k_start_timer(&req->timer, req->timer_intv);
+
+       spin_unlock_bh(&req->bearer->publ.lock);
+}
